Overview of Contract Law in Oklahoma
Contract law in Oklahoma governs the formation, execution, and enforcement of agreements between parties. Traditionally, contracts must include an offer, acceptance, consideration, and mutual intent to be legally binding. However, as we approach 2026, various factors may prompt changes in this area.
Potential Legislative Changes
Several legislative proposals are under consideration that may impact contract law in Oklahoma. These changes could address issues such as:
- Electronic Contracts: The rise of digital transactions has led to discussions about updating laws to better accommodate electronic signatures and contracts.
- Consumer Protection: New regulations may focus on enhancing consumer rights in contractual agreements, especially concerning unfair terms and conditions.
- Enforceability of Non-Compete Clauses: There may be changes regarding the enforceability of non-compete agreements, particularly in employment contracts.
Impact on Businesses
As businesses in Tulsa and across Oklahoma prepare for these changes, understanding the potential implications is vital. Here are some areas where you may need to adapt:
- Contract Drafting: Businesses may need to revise how they draft contracts to comply with new requirements, particularly regarding consumer protection laws.
- Negotiation Strategies: With changes in enforceability of clauses, negotiation strategies may need to evolve to better protect business interests.
- Compliance Training: Companies may need to invest in training for their teams to ensure compliance with updated contract laws.

Common Contract Issues
As you navigate potential changes, be aware of common contract issues that may arise:
- Breach of Contract: Understand the grounds for breach and the potential remedies available.
- Ambiguities: Ensure that contracts are clear to prevent disputes over interpretation.
- Termination Clauses: Be conscious of how termination rights may change under new laws.
